    Cardiac Telemetry Technician Details

    Essential Job Duties:

  • Patient care: Monitors patient cardiac rhythms, responds to alarms, reports dysrhythmias to nursing staff, and documents rhythm strips.

  • Professionalism: Maintains confidentiality, exercises tact and diplomacy, accepts additional tasks, and communicates effectively with coworkers and supervisors.

  • Professional growth: Takes advantage of educational offerings, consults with supervisors, and makes suggestions for improvement.

  • Telemetry surveillance: Observes data generated from central cardiac monitors, records rhythm strips, assists with emergencies, and observes the effects of medications.

  • Documentation and reporting: Labels and distributes trend reports, signs off on arrhythmia sheets, prepares reports for oncoming staff, and records patient data/events in the medical record.

    Qualifications:

  • High school diploma or equivalent

  • Basic knowledge of cardiac anatomy and medical terminology

  • Completion of a basic cardiac arrhythmia class

  • CRAT Certification preferred

  • EKG reading experience in acute care setting preferred

  • Cardiac Monitor technician experience or successful completion of a cardiac dysrhythmia course preferred

    License/Certification:

  • BLS level of CPR certification required
